Role: Event Housing ManagerLocation: Remote (occasional onsite presence in Feltham)
The Event Housing Manager plays a pivotal role in managing all aspects of housing and accommodations for our events, ensuring a comfortable and convenient experience for attendees. This position requires exceptional organizational skills, attention to detail, and the ability to coordinate lodging logistics for large-scale events. The Event Housing Manager will work closely with event planners, hotels, and attendees to secure and manage lodging arrangements.
Key Responsibilities:
Housing Logistics:
- Design housing requirements, including room blocks, rates, and special requests.
- Research and select suitable hotels and accommodations near event venues.
- Negotiate contracts with hotels, securing favorable terms and rates for event attendees.
Reservations and Booking:
- Create and manage housing reservation systems or platforms for attendees to book accommodations.
- Assist attendees with reservations, changes, and special requests related to their lodging.
- Monitor and manage room blocks, ensuring proper utilization and minimizing attrition.
Communication and Customer Service:
- Serve as the main point of contact for attendees with housing-related inquiries.
- Provide timely and courteous responses to housing questions and issues via email or phone.
- Assist attendees in resolving housing-related concerns and ensuring their comfort during their stay.
Rooming List Management:
- Maintain accurate rooming lists and share them with hotels and event planners as needed.
- Manage hotels and their room blocks to ensure room assignments align with attendees' preferences and event needs.
- Address any rooming list discrepancies promptly.
Billing and Financial Management:
- Oversee billing and payment processes related to housing reservations.
- Reconcile housing revenue and expenses, ensuring accurate financial records.
- Collaborate with finance and accounting teams to address any billing discrepancies.
On-Site Support:
- Provide on-site support during events, assisting attendees with check-in/check-out processes and addressing housing-related issues.
- Liaise with hotels to resolve any on-site concerns and ensure a seamless experience for attendees.
